Decoding the Exadata X8m-2 Datasheet

The Exadata X8m-2 Datasheet is essentially a comprehensive blueprint. It outlines everything from the hardware components like CPUs, memory, and storage, to the software features that enable extreme performance. Think of it as the owner’s manual for a high-performance race car; it tells you what parts are under the hood and how they work together to achieve peak speed. The datasheet details the server and storage configurations available, networking capabilities, and supported Oracle Database versions. Understanding this document allows database administrators, architects, and IT professionals to properly size the system for their specific needs and plan for future growth. Its accurate use and interpretation are critical for ensuring the Exadata X8m-2 delivers optimal performance and ROI.

Datasheets are used in several key ways. First, they are essential during the planning and procurement phase. By reviewing the specifications, organizations can determine if the Exadata X8m-2 meets their performance, scalability, and availability requirements. Second, datasheets are invaluable during the deployment and configuration process. They provide detailed information about the system’s architecture and how to properly configure it for optimal performance. Finally, datasheets serve as a reference guide for ongoing maintenance and troubleshooting. Here’s a breakdown of the key sections often found within an Exadata X8m-2 Datasheet:

  • Hardware Specifications: CPU, memory, storage capacity, and networking details.
  • Software Features: Oracle Database version support, Exadata-specific features.
  • Scalability Options: Information on scaling up or out the system.
  • Availability and Reliability: Details on redundancy and fault tolerance.
